Nerthebrochus sulcata

Rhynchonellata - Terebratulida - Sellithyrididae

Taxonomy
Nerthebrochus sulcata was named by Simon (2005). Its type specimen is NHMM GK 1287, a shell, and it is a 3D body fossil. Its type locality is Slenaken-Kerkdel (62C-15), which is in a Maastrichtian carbonate chalk in the Gulpen Formation of the Netherlands.
